Don't Miss: The pixies are back in the spotlight as Gabby Douglas, Jordyn Wieber and the U.S. women's gymnastics team goes for the gold-medal team final. Will there be another Kerri Strug-like dramatic moment? The U.S. is favored after winning the 2011 world title. Stay tuned.

Other Highlights: Another busy day at the pool, including Phelps in the 200 fly and the U.S. team in the men's 800 free relay and Franklin in the women's 200 free, who will battle fellow American Allison Schmitt. The U.S. women's soccer plays North Korea, the U.S. men's volleyball team faces Germany, and the U.S. men's basketball team will be heavily favored over Tunisia.

WEDNESDAY

Don't Miss: Danell Leyva is back in the spotlight as he competes for the men's gymnastics all-around final. The man to beat is Kohei Uchimura of Japan, the three-time world champion, who won silver at the 2008 Beijing Games. Leyva's U.S. teammate, John Orozco, is also a medal contender.

Other Highlights: The telegenic beach volleyball players will get plenty of airtime, as they play on a makeshift beach near Buckingham Palace. Misty May-Treanor and Kerri Walsh try to three-peat. The U.S. women's volleyball team has a tough match against China, and the U.S. women's basketball team plays Turkey. Track cycling is sure to get a lot of coverage in England with British star Chris "The Real McCoy'' Hoy in action.
